That energy door doesn't guard anything you need at this time to make further progress - there is an extra energy cell but it won't do much to help you progress now anyway.
The solution is to proceed through the area to the left of the door. It has some crazy jumps that will require double jump. Proceeding through this area and up the walls will lead you out of the area entirely and provide you with the Vein.
